InternationalOman issues royal decree granting citizenship to 226 individualsBy Web Desk-Apr 19, 2026 MUSCAT: Oman’s Sultan Haitham bin Tariq has issued a royal decree granting Omani citizenship to 226 individuals. The decree, No. 46/2026, was published in the Official Gazette on April 19, listing the names of those approved for citizenship. The decision comes within the framework of Oman’s nationality law, which sets out detailed and stringent conditions for granting citizenship to foreign nationals. Continuous Residents Under the law, applicants must have resided legally and continuously in Oman for no less than 15 years, with absences not exceeding 90 days per year. Proficiency in Arabic They are also required to demonstrate proficiency in Arabic, maintain a record of good conduct, and have no prior convictions in crimes involving dishonour or breach of trust. Good health In addition, applicants must be in good health, free from infectious diseases, and able to show a stable and legitimate source of income sufficient to support themselves and their dependents. Renounce Existing Nationality A formal written commitment to renounce their existing nationality is also required. Women Can Also become Omani Citizens The law provides tailored pathways for spouses of Omani citizens. Foreign men married to Omani women Foreign men married to Omani women may apply for citizenship after 10 years of continuous residence and marriage, provided they have children and meet language, conduct and financial requirements. Foreign women married to Omani men Foreign women married to Omani men may apply after eight years, while widows may be eligible after six years of residence following their husband’s death. Divorced women Divorced women may also apply under specific conditions, including prior years of marriage, residency and the presence of children.
